Velsicol
Velsiflex® 342
Function: Plasticizer
Chemical Family: Benzoates, Diols, Carboxylic Acids & Derivatives, Glycols
End Uses: Plastisol Adhesive, Powder Coating, Gravure Ink, Lacquers
Compatible Polymers & Resins: Polyurethanes (PU)
Labeling Claims: Phthalates-free, Environmentally Friendly
Velsiflex® 342 is one of the most popular liquid plasticizers. It is a high-solvating plasticizer containing mostly dipropylene glycol dibenzoate. It is used in a wide variety of applications, including caulk, adhesives, resilient flooring, PVC-coated fabrics and artificial-leather cloth. In PVC, it acts as a medium- viscosity high solvator that saves energy and improves process ability. Vinyl applications using Velsiflex 342 have excellent resistance to extraction from solvents and oils. It also works with vinyl to make it UV – light-degradation resistant and stain resistant.

PolyAziridine Global
PolyAziridine Global PZE-1000
Function: Crosslinking Agent
Chemical Family: Aziridines
End Uses: Waterborne Coating, Waterborne Adhesive, Waterborne Ink
Synonyms: Pentaerythritol tris(3-aziridin-1-ylpropionate)
PolyAziridine Global PZE-1000 is an ethylene imine based tri-functional polyaziridine that is used as a cross-linker for both aqueous and non-aqueous coatings, inks, and adhesives to promote both physical and chemical properties. With the highest level of functionality at 3.3, it yields the highest level of cross-link density of polyfunctional aziridines. The aziridine end groups can react with active hydrogen as found on carboxyl groups of acrylic emulsions or polyurethane dispersions. PZE-1000 also has a hydroxyl group, which allows it to dispersion readily into aqueous systems. PZE-1000 is added at levels of 1% to 3% to finished formulated coatings, inks, or adhesives. It is added slowly and under good agitation. After mixing, an aqueous system with a pH of 9.0-9.5 will typically have a pot life of 18-36 hours. This time will be reduced when the pH is lower.

AB Specialty Silicones
Andisil® OH 50,000
Function: Adhesion Promoter, Anti-Structuring Agent, Coupling Agent
Chemical Family: Silicones, Silicon-based Compounds
Labeling Claims: Plasticizer-free, Additive-free
Features: Good Stability, Excellent Stability
Andisil® OH 50,000 is a Silanol terminated fluid.Andisil® OH Polymers are a series of silanol functional fluids with various viscosities and silanol contents. They are useful in the treatment of fillers and as Anti-Structuring additives in high consistency silicone rubber and silicone Room Temperature Vulcanizing (RTV) formulations. The low viscosity grades can be used as reactive diluents for high viscosity polymers to adjust the overall viscosity of the formulation. They have excellent stability and can be used with catalytic amounts of ammonium carbonate to treat reinforcing fillers in-situ. Andisil® OH products are pure and do not contain any plasticizers or additives. Curing of the Andisil® OH series can be achieved by all usual condensation crosslinkers (i.e. Alkoxy silanes, oxime silanes, acetoxy silanes) in conjunction with catalysts—the use of dibutyl tin dilaurate or stannous octoate have been found effective as catalysts for these reaction.


AB Specialty Silicones
Andisil® VQM 2050
Function: Reinforcement
Chemical Family: Siloxanes, Vinyls, Vinylics & Vinyl Derivatives, Silicones
Features: Fast Curing, Good Mechanical Properties, Good Tear Strength, Excellent Dimensional Accuracy
End Uses: Dental Applications
Andisil® VQM Products are additives for the improvement of mechanical properties of addition cured silicone elastomers. The curing mechanism of vinyl-functional silicone polymers (Andisil® VS) is a platinum catalyzed addition reaction with silicone crosslinkers containing silicon-hydride groups. The mechanical properties of the unfilled RTV are rather poor. Therefore the properties are improved with the addition of appropriate fillers i. e. Carbon black, fumed or precipitated silica and other fillers well known to formulators with expertise in compounding silicones. Andisil® VQM Products are comprised of vinyl-functional silicone polymers and vinyl-functional QM-resins. The product group is beneficial in formulating filler free, transparent systems which require good mechanical properties. The products will also enhance improvement of mechanical properties of filled formulations.

Momentive Performance Materials
Silquestâ„¢ A-171
Function: Coupling Agent, Crosslinking Agent, Moisture Scavenger, Adhesion Promoter
Chemical Family: Silanes
Compatible Polymers & Resins: Acrylics
Molecular Weight: 148.2 - 148.2 g/mol
Features: Chemical Resistance
Silquestâ„¢ A-171 silane offers vinyl and silane functionality and also can be utilized for chain extension of RTV silicones or OH functional polymers. This results in Si-O-Si crosslink sites that are highly resistant to the effects of exposure to moisture, chemicals and UV rays. As a siloxane crosslinker, Silquestâ„¢ A-171 silane typically does not generate color and is resistant to acid rain under most conditions. This silane is also useful as a moisture scavenger in moisture cure systems where improved shelf life is desired.
